Abstract

It is intended to promote enhancement of performance of acquiring a depth image. A depth image acquiring apparatus includes a light emitting diode, a TOF sensor, and a filter. The light emitting diode irradiates modulated light toward a detection area becoming an area in which a depth image is to be acquired to detect a distance. The TOF sensor receives incident light into which the light irradiated from the light emitting diode is reflected by an object lying in the detection area to become, thereby outputting a signal used to produce the depth image. The filter passes more light having a wavelength in a predetermined pass bandwidth than light having a wavelength in a pass bandwidth other than the predetermined pass bandwidth of the light made incident toward the TOF sensor. In this case, at least one of the light emitting diode, the TOF sensor, or arrangement of the filter is controlled in accordance with a temperature of the light emitting diode or the TOF sensor.
